Assessing Your Backyard and Preparation the Layout



When you're all set to install a lawn sprinkler system, the initial action is examining your backyard and preparing the layout. Take note of sun direct exposure and any shaded places, as these elements influence water demands.


Next, consider the water pressure readily available to you. Examine it making use of a straightforward stress scale to verify your system can work effectively. Strategy the placement of sprinkler heads based upon coverage; you'll want them to overlap a little to stay clear of dry patches.


Lay out a harsh design, noting the locations of the primary lines and sprinkler heads. Think of the kinds of lawn sprinklers you'll make use of and their reach. Planning very carefully currently will make your setup less complicated and verify your plants get the correct amount of water.

Figuring Out Trench Depth



Identifying the ideal trench deepness is essential for ensuring your sprinkler system functions efficiently. Normally, you'll wish to dig trenches about 6 to 12 inches deep, depending upon your regional climate and the kind of pipes you're utilizing. If you stay in a location with freezing temperatures, deeper trenches aid protect against pipelines from cold. Make certain to take right into account the size of your pipes; larger pipelines might need much deeper trenches for correct installation. In addition, inspect neighborhood codes or regulations, as they might dictate details depth requirements. As you dig, keep the trench width convenient-- around 12 inches is typically enough. In this manner, you can easily mount and access the pipes when needed, ensuring your system runs smoothly.

Connecting the Key Water System



With the lawn sprinkler heads and shutoffs safely in place, you'll currently connect the major supply of water to your irrigation system. Beginning by locating the major water line, normally near your home's foundation. Close off the water supply to stop any leaks or spills throughout the process. Next off, use a pipeline cutter to produce a clean cut in the primary line, making particular it's the appropriate size for your fittings. Set up a T-fitting to draw away water into your lawn sprinkler system. Make certain it's securely safeguarded, and usage Teflon tape on the threads for a leak-proof seal. Afterwards, connect the PVC pipe leading to your lawn sprinkler to the T-fitting. Verify all connections are leak-free and tight. Once whatever remains in area, turn the supply of water back on gradually, checking for any leakages at the joints. This step is important for a smooth procedure of your lawn sprinkler.
